Click to display the crosshairs for the first cursor. c. Right-click to display the crosshairs for the second cursor. Table 2-1 Association of cursors with mouse buttons. In the trace legend, the part for V(In) is outlined in the crosshair pattern for each cursor, resulting in a dashed line as shown in Figure 2-11. 3. Place the first cursor on the V(In) waveform: a. Click the portion of the V(In) trace in the proximity of 4 volts on the x-axis. The cursor crosshair appears, and the current X and Y values for the first cursor appear in the cursor window. b. To fine-tune the cursor location to 4 volts on the x-axis, drag the crosshairs until the x-axis value of the A1 cursor in the cursor window is approximately 4.0. You can also press Right arrow key and Left arrow key for tighter control. Note: Your ability to get as close to 4.0 as possible depends on screen resolution and window size. 4. Place the second cursor on the V(Mid) waveform: a. Right-click the trace legend part (diamond) for V(Mid) to associate the second cursor with the Mid waveform.
